Definition of Buddhism as it relates to Religions, Deism, Philosophy Of Religions

Buddhism, as it pertains to the philosophy of religions, explores the fundamental nature of existence and reality from a unique perspective within this hierarchy. Drawing on foundational concepts such as impermanence, non-self, and dependent origination, it delves into the human condition and its relationship with the ultimate truth. It questions the nature of suffering and provides insights into the path towards liberation. In doing so, Buddhism offers a framework that complements the study of other religions and deistic systems while also contributing to our understanding of the philosophical aspects of religious beliefs and practices.
